A difference between common SiC substrates and SmartSiC substrates is their colour and transparency. Nitrogen doped mono-SiC 4H-SiC is distinctive in becoming Virtually transparent, by using a colour I am advised is near to olivine. The apparent variance would be that the poly-SiC is black and opaque, as viewed in Fig six. When requested with regard to the influence of this transformation on fabrication tools for example photolithography, now set up with optical sensors tuned for mono-SiC substrates, Soitec played down this problem, commenting that they work with customers to make the changes essential.

It truly is believed that the ductility of SiC for the duration of machining is due to formation of a superior-tension period with the cutting edge, which encompasses the chip development zone and its affiliated content volume. This high-force stage transformation system is comparable to that identified with other semiconductors and ceramics, leading to a plastic reaction as an alternative to brittle fracture at modest dimension scales.
